Doors of Opportunity

Have you ever stopped and asked yourself what does the fragrance of Christ smell like? The Apostle Paul states that we are sweet fragrance unto God, the aroma of death to the perishing and aroma of life leading to life.

Be intentional today about diffusing the fragrance of Christ through the doors of opportunity (possibilities due to a favorable combination of circumstances; and a good chance for advancement or progress) that are opened to you.
  

2 Corinthians 2:12-17 (Amplified Bible)

12Now when I arrived at Troas [to preach] the good news (the Gospel) of Christ, a door of opportunity was opened for me in the Lord,
    13Yet my spirit could not rest (relax, get relief) because I did not find my brother Titus there. So I took leave from them and departed for Macedonia.
    14But thanks be to God, Who in Christ always leads us in triumph [as trophies of Christ's victory] and through us spreads and makes evident the fragrance of the knowledge of God everywhere,
    15For we are the sweet fragrance of Christ [which exhales] unto God, [discernible alike] among those who are being saved and among those who are perishing:
    16To the latter it is an aroma [wafted] from death to death [a fatal odor, the smell of doom]; to the former it is an aroma from life to life [a vital fragrance, living and fresh]. And who is qualified (fit and sufficient) for these things? [Who is able for such a ministry? We?]
    17For we are not, like so many, [like hucksters making a trade of] peddling God's Word [shortchanging and adulterating the divine message]; but like [men] of sincerity and the purest motive, as [commissioned and sent] by God, we speak [His message] in Christ (the Messiah), in the [very] sight and presence of God.
